The idea of Eddie's Drive-In is a '50s car hop restaurant by the original Eddie & Mary Catherin in 1987. It's a family place to take the kids for an ice cream treat. There is even real roller skating car hop waitresses who roll up to your window to take your order. Fast forward as Sharyl Collins took control in 2014 with some great surprises and themes set for this year's season.

The menu is just what you remember a car hop would serve... hotdogs, corn dogs, fries, and a nice mug of root beer. Eddie's Drive-In's signature dish is the "BIG Ed's Burger ",  1/3 pound of ground round beef, lettuce, tomato, onion, and Eddie's favorite sauce.

The "Screamin Burger," Sharyl Collins, asked me to design a signature burger. It's a 1/3 pound of ground round beef, lettuce, tomato, cheese, bacon, thick onion rings, and the famous Ed sauce with some Sriracha hot sauce. The "Screamin Burger" is a hit every season!

Menu favorites include homemade Eddie's Pizza, Grilled Cajun or Lemon Salmon Filet, BBQ Pulled Pork Sandwich, Old Fashioned Shakes & Malts, and an Old Fashioned Vernors Ice cream Cooler. Remind me to let Big Jim's house know about Eddie's Drive-In. 

For a look at their menu visit EddiesDriveIn.com. Interested in visiting? Eddie's Drive-In is located at 36111 Jefferson Ave, Harrison Twp, MI 48045
